Types of Wireless Connections

Printers utilize various wireless connection methods to interface with devices. Each method offers distinct advantages in terms of ease of use, range, and compatibility.

  • Wi-Fi Direct: This technology allows devices to connect directly to each other without requiring an intermediary router or access point. It creates a temporary, ad-hoc network between the printer and the laptop, making it ideal for quick printing when a traditional Wi-Fi network is unavailable or for simplified setups.
  • Network Connection (Wi-Fi): In this setup, both the printer and the laptop connect to a common wireless router or access point. This is the most common method, allowing multiple devices on the network to access the printer. It provides a stable and persistent connection for regular printing needs.

Common Wireless Protocols

Several wireless protocols facilitate the communication between your laptop and printer, ensuring that data is transmitted accurately and efficiently. These protocols define the rules and formats for data exchange.

  • Wi-Fi (IEEE 802.11 standards): This is the foundational technology for most wireless network connections. Printers supporting Wi-Fi connect to your home or office wireless network using the established 802.11 standards (e.g., 802.11b, g, n, ac, ax).
  • WPS (Wi-Fi Protected Setup): WPS simplifies the process of connecting devices to a Wi-Fi network. Many printers offer a WPS button that, when pressed simultaneously with a WPS button on the router, allows for an automated and secure connection without manually entering the Wi-Fi password.
  • Bluetooth: While less common for full-featured printers, some portable or specialized printers may use Bluetooth for short-range wireless printing. This protocol creates a personal area network (PAN) between devices.
  • Bonjour (Multicast DNS Service Discovery): Developed by Apple, Bonjour helps devices on a network discover each other automatically. It allows your laptop to find and connect to available printers without manual configuration.
  • mDNS (Multicast DNS): Similar to Bonjour, mDNS is a network protocol that automatically discovers services and devices on a local network.

Utilizing WPS (Wi-Fi Protected Setup)

Wi-Fi Protected Setup (WPS) is a feature designed to simplify the process of connecting devices to a wireless network. If both your router and printer support WPS, you can connect them without needing to manually enter your Wi-Fi password.There are two primary methods for using WPS:

  1. Push Button Method:
    • On your printer’s control panel, navigate to the wireless setup options and select “WPS” or “Wi-Fi Protected Setup.”
    • Choose the “Push Button” or “PBC” option.
    • Within a short timeframe (typically two minutes), press the WPS button on your wireless router. This button is often labeled with an icon resembling two arrows forming a circle or simply “WPS.”
    • The printer and router will then automatically negotiate a connection. A successful connection will be indicated on the printer’s display.
  2. PIN Method:
    • On your printer, select the WPS option and choose “PIN Code.” The printer will generate an 8-digit PIN.
    • Access your router’s administration interface through a web browser on your laptop. The typical address is 192.168.1.1 or 192.168.0.1. Consult your router’s manual if you are unsure.
    • Locate the WPS settings within the router’s interface.
    • Enter the PIN code displayed on your printer into the designated field on your router’s configuration page.
    • Apply the changes on the router. The printer should then connect to the network.

It is important to note that the WPS Push Button method is generally considered more secure than the PIN method, as the PIN method has been known to be vulnerable to brute-force attacks.

Alternative Connection Methods

If your printer does not support WPS, or if you encounter issues with the WPS method, there are alternative ways to connect your printer to the network.One common alternative is to use a temporary wired connection to set up the wireless connection:

  • Some printers come with an Ethernet port. Connect the printer to your router using an Ethernet cable.
  • Access the printer’s network settings via its control panel.
  • Look for an option to “Copy IP settings from wired to wireless” or a similar function. This will allow the printer to adopt the network settings from the wired connection and apply them to its wireless interface.
  • Once the wireless settings are configured, you can disconnect the Ethernet cable, and the printer should remain connected to your Wi-Fi network.

Another method, particularly for printers without a display screen, involves using manufacturer-specific software on your laptop:

  • Download and install the printer’s driver and utility software from the manufacturer’s official website.
  • During the installation process, you will be prompted to connect the printer. Select the wireless setup option.
  • The software will guide you through the process, which may involve temporarily connecting the printer to your laptop via USB to transfer the Wi-Fi network name and password to the printer.
  • Once the wireless credentials have been sent to the printer, it will disconnect from the USB and attempt to connect to your Wi-Fi network.

Obtaining the Printer’s IP Address

Knowing your printer’s IP address is essential for manual configuration, troubleshooting network issues, or accessing advanced printer settings through a web browser. The IP address is a unique numerical label assigned to each device connected to a computer network.You can obtain your printer’s IP address through several methods:

  • From the Printer’s Control Panel: Navigate through the printer’s network settings menu. There is usually an option to view network status, network configuration, or IP address. This information will be displayed on the printer’s screen.
  • Print a Network Configuration Page: Most printers have a function to print a detailed network configuration report. This report will list all relevant network information, including the IP address, subnet mask, and default gateway. This option is typically found within the printer’s setup or maintenance menus.
  • Via Your Router’s Administration Interface: Log in to your router’s web-based administration page. Look for a section listing connected devices or a DHCP client list. Your printer should be listed with its assigned IP address.
  • Using Command Prompt (Windows): If your printer is already connected to the network, you can sometimes find its IP address using the command prompt. Open Command Prompt, type arp -a, and press Enter. This command lists the IP and MAC addresses of devices on your network. You may need to identify your printer by its MAC address, which can often be found on a label on the printer itself or in its network configuration report.

The IP address will typically appear in a format similar to 192.168.1.100 or 10.0.0.5.

Troubleshooting Steps if the Printer is Not Detected

It is not uncommon for a printer to not appear immediately in the list of available devices during the addition process. Several factors can contribute to this, and a systematic approach to troubleshooting can resolve most detection issues.If your wireless printer is not detected by Windows during the addition process, consider the following troubleshooting steps:

  • Verify Network Connectivity: Ensure both your laptop and the printer are connected to the
    -exact same* Wi-Fi network. Mismatched networks are a primary cause of detection failures. Check the printer’s network status screen or manual for confirmation.
  • Restart Devices: A simple restart can often resolve temporary network glitches. Power off both your router and your printer, wait for about 30 seconds, and then power them back on. Restart your laptop as well.
  • Check Printer’s Network Status: Confirm that the printer’s wireless adapter is enabled and that it has successfully obtained an IP address from your router. Consult your printer’s manual for instructions on how to access its network settings.
  • Firewall and Antivirus: Your laptop’s firewall or antivirus software might be blocking network discovery. Temporarily disable them to see if the printer is detected. If it is, you will need to configure your security software to allow network printer discovery.
  • Printer Drivers: Although you may have already installed drivers, ensure they are up-to-date. Sometimes, older drivers can cause communication issues. Visit the printer manufacturer’s website to download the latest drivers.
  • Network Discovery in Windows: Ensure that network discovery is enabled on your Windows laptop. You can usually find this setting under Network and Sharing Center > Change advanced sharing settings.
  • Manual IP Address Addition: If the printer is still not detected, you can try adding it manually by its IP address. You will need to know the printer’s IP address (obtainable from the printer’s network status screen or your router’s connected devices list). In the “Add a printer or scanner” window, click “The printer that I want isn’t listed” and then select “Add a printer using a TCP/IP address or hostname.”

Utilizing the “Add Printer, Scanner, or Fax” Function

Once the “Add Printer” dialog box appears, macOS will begin searching for available printers on your network. This is where the wireless connectivity established in the previous steps becomes vital.The system employs various protocols to discover printers, such as Bonjour (also known as Zeroconf), which is commonly used by wireless printers for automatic detection. If your printer is not immediately detected, you may need to manually specify its connection type.

The “Add Printer, Scanner, or Fax” window typically displays three tabs:

  • Default: This tab shows printers that macOS has automatically discovered on your network. If your printer appears here, it is the simplest method for addition.
  • IP: This tab allows you to manually add a printer by entering its IP address. This is useful if Bonjour discovery fails or if you know the printer’s static IP address. You will need to select the appropriate protocol (e.g., LPD, IPP, HP Jetdirect) and enter the printer’s IP address.
  • Windows: This tab is used for adding printers shared from a Windows computer, which is not the primary focus of this wireless printer setup but is available for broader network integration.

Checking Firewall Settings for Communication Blocks

Firewall and antivirus software are designed to protect your computer from unauthorized access, but they can sometimes mistakenly block legitimate network traffic, including communication with your wireless printer. It is essential to ensure that your security software is not preventing your laptop from communicating with the printer over the network.To check and adjust firewall settings:

  1. Identify Printer Communication Ports: Most printer manufacturers specify the ports that their devices use for network communication. These are often documented in the printer’s manual or on the manufacturer’s support website. Common ports include TCP ports 9100, 515, and UDP ports 161, 137, 138, 139.
  2. Access Firewall Settings: On Windows, you can access the Windows Defender Firewall by searching for “Windows Defender Firewall” in the Start menu. On macOS, firewall settings are typically found under System Preferences > Security & Privacy > Firewall.
  3. Create an Exception: Within your firewall settings, look for an option to add an exception or allow an application or port through the firewall. You may need to add the printer’s specific IP address or the ports it uses.
  4. Temporarily Disable Firewall: As a diagnostic step, you can temporarily disable your firewall to see if printing is restored. Remember to re-enable the firewall immediately after testing to maintain your system’s security. If printing works with the firewall disabled, you know the firewall is the cause and can then focus on configuring it correctly.
  5. Check Antivirus Software: Similarly, your antivirus software may have its own firewall component or network protection features that could be blocking the printer. Consult your antivirus software’s documentation for instructions on how to create exceptions or allow specific network devices.

For instance, if your firewall is blocking port 9100, and your printer uses this port for communication, your laptop will be unable to send print jobs to it. Configuring the firewall to allow traffic on this specific port, especially from your local network, will resolve this issue.

Accessing and Modifying Printer Settings via Web Interface

The printer’s web interface serves as a central hub for managing its advanced functionalities. By entering the printer’s IP address into your web browser’s address bar, you can access a graphical user interface that mirrors the printer’s control panel but offers more extensive options. This interface is crucial for tasks such as changing network configurations, managing user accounts, and setting up specialized printing features.To access the web interface:

  • Locate the printer’s IP address. This can often be found on the printer’s control panel display, by printing a network configuration page, or by checking your router’s connected devices list.
  • Open a web browser (e.g., Chrome, Firefox, Edge) on a computer connected to the same wireless network as the printer.
  • Type the printer’s IP address into the browser’s address bar and press Enter.
  • You may be prompted for a username and password. Default credentials are often found in the printer’s manual or on the manufacturer’s website.

Once logged in, you will typically find menus for network settings (Wi-Fi, Ethernet, TCP/IP), security options (passwords, access control), printing management (default settings, job queues), and system information (firmware version, status).

Network Printer Sharing, How to install a wireless printer on my laptop

Configuring printer sharing allows multiple devices on your network to access a single printer, even if it’s connected wirelessly. This is particularly useful in home or small office environments where a central printer serves several users. Network sharing can be managed either through the printer’s web interface or through the operating system’s sharing features.Methods for setting up printer sharing on a network include:

  • Printer’s Built-in Sharing: Some printers have native network sharing capabilities that can be enabled through their web interface. This often involves assigning a network name to the printer that other devices can search for.
  • Operating System Sharing (Windows): In Windows, after the printer is installed on one computer, you can share it with other computers on the network. This is done via the Control Panel or Settings app, under “Devices and Printers” or “Printers & scanners.” Right-click the printer, select “Printer properties,” and then navigate to the “Sharing” tab to enable sharing and assign a share name.

  • Operating System Sharing (macOS): On macOS, printer sharing is managed through System Preferences (or System Settings). Select “Printers & Scanners,” choose your printer, and then go to the “Sharing” tab to enable “Printer Sharing.” Other Macs on the network can then add the shared printer via their own “Printers & Scanners” settings.

For effective sharing, ensure that network discovery and file and printer sharing are enabled on the computers that will be accessing the printer.

Secure Wireless Printing Configuration

Securing your wireless printer is paramount to prevent unauthorized access and protect sensitive documents. Advanced configurations include setting strong passwords, enabling encryption, and controlling access to the printer’s network.Key aspects of configuring secure wireless printing options include:

  • Password Protection: Set a strong, unique password for accessing the printer’s web interface and any administrative functions. Avoid using default passwords.
  • WPA2/WPA3 Encryption: Ensure your wireless network is secured with WPA2 or WPA3 encryption. This encrypts the data transmitted between the printer and your router, making it difficult for unauthorized parties to intercept.
  • Network Access Control (MAC Filtering): Some routers and printers allow you to configure MAC address filtering, which permits only devices with specific MAC addresses to connect to the network. This adds an extra layer of security, though it requires manual management of each device’s MAC address.
  • Firewall Settings: Configure your router’s firewall to restrict access to the printer’s ports from external networks.
  • Disable Unused Services: If your printer offers services you do not use (e.g., FTP, Telnet), disable them through the web interface to reduce the attack surface.

AirPrint

AirPrint is Apple’s proprietary printing solution that allows iOS and macOS devices to print wirelessly to AirPrint-compatible printers without the need to download drivers or software. For AirPrint to function, both the Apple device and the printer must be connected to the same Wi-Fi network.The setup involves ensuring the printer is connected to the Wi-Fi network and that AirPrint is enabled on the printer.

When a user wishes to print from an iPhone, iPad, or Mac, they can select the print option within an application, and AirPrint automatically discovers nearby printers.
